Course Details

• Advanced 2D Materials
• Graphene: Properties and Applications
• Transition Metal Dichalcogenides (TMDs)
• Topological Insulators and Superconductors
• Quantum Confined Structures
• van der Waals Heterostructures
• 2D Materials Growth Techniques
• Characterization of 2D Materials
• Quantum Transport in 2D Materials
• Applications in Quantum Computing

Quantum Computing Engineer: With a 30% share of the job market, quantum computing engineers are responsible for designing, developing, and optimizing quantum algorithms, hardware, and software. These professionals play a crucial role in advancing quantum computing research and applications. 2D Materials Researcher: These experts focus on the study and development of two-dimensional materials, which have unique electrical and optical properties, making them ideal for quantum systems. With a 25% market share, 2D materials researchers contribute significantly to the growth of the quantum technology sector. Data Scientist (Quantum Focus): These data science specialists apply their skills to quantum systems, developing machine learning algorithms, analyzing large datasets, and creating predictive models. With a 20% share of the job market, data scientists with a quantum focus are essential to the industry's growth. Quantum System Developer: Quantum system developers design, build, and maintain quantum computing systems, collaborating with researchers and engineers to create reliable, cutting-edge technology. This role accounts for 15% of the job market. Quantum Technology Consultant: As trusted advisors, quantum technology consultants help businesses and organizations understand and implement quantum solutions, ensuring they stay at the forefront of technological advancements. This role represents a 10% share of the job market.
